Maintenance Playbook
Book a pump every 4 years for typical households; reduce the interval with large families or disposal use. Stagger laundry loads, limit bleach-heavy cleaners, and keep wipes out of the system.
Divert roof runoff away from the drain field. Maintain grass cover, avoid heavy vehicles, and mark lids so service is swift. Store permits and past reports for a complete history.

Your drain field may be buried, but it is the core of the system. We help Hunt County TX owners to shield it by keeping grass cover, moving roof water, and avoiding heavy loads. If absorption slows, we jet laterals, rebalance dosing, and follow recovery before suggesting replacement.
